Chambal Fertilisers slips after sharp decline in Q4 net

The standalone net profit for March quarter dropped nearly 76% to Rs 5.63 crore

Chambal Fertilisers was down nearly 3% at Rs 40,  in an otherwise booming market, after the company reported sharp drop in net profit for the fourth quarter ended March 31, 2014.

The company's net profit for the quarter ended March 31, 2014 fell sharply by 76% to Rs 5.63 crore compared with 22.94 crore in the corresponding quarter last fiscal, the company said in a release after market hours on Friday.

Net Income for the quarter fell nearly 7% to Rs 1441.18 crore compared with 1,543.44 crore in the same quarter last fiscal.

For the fiscal ended March 31, 2014, the net profit was marginally lower at Rs 303.07 crore compared with Rs 305.61 crore in the previous fiscal. Net income for 2013-14 was up nearly 9% to Rs 7,976.42 crore compared with Rs 7,337.48 crore in the previous fiscal.
 

Meanwhile, the board has recommended a dividend of Rs 1.90 per equity share for the year ended March 31, 2014.
